Updated infinite scroll

This commit is contained in:
JakubDrobnik 2018-11-21 14:15:51 +01:00
parent 111048aee4
commit 6ee60e203c

View File

@ -63,19 +63,15 @@ module.exports = async (page, maxHeight, elementToScroll = 'body') => {
interceptedRequest.continue(); interceptedRequest.continue();
}); });
page.on('requestfailed', (interceptedRequest) => { page.on('requestfailed', (interceptedRequest) => {
if (maybeResourceTypesInfiniteScroll.includes(interceptedRequest.resourceType)) { if (pendingRequests[interceptedRequest._requestId]) {
if (pendingRequests[interceptedRequest._requestId]) { delete pendingRequests[interceptedRequest._requestId];
delete pendingRequests[interceptedRequest._requestId]; ++resourcesStats.failed;
++resourcesStats.failed;
}
} }
}); });
page.on('requestfinished', (interceptedRequest) => { page.on('requestfinished', (interceptedRequest) => {
if (maybeResourceTypesInfiniteScroll.includes(interceptedRequest.resourceType)) { if (pendingRequests[interceptedRequest._requestId]) {
if (pendingRequests[interceptedRequest._requestId]) { delete pendingRequests[interceptedRequest._requestId];
delete pendingRequests[interceptedRequest._requestId]; ++resourcesStats.finished;
++resourcesStats.finished;
}
} }
}); });